Australian Open favourite Naomi Osaka calls out ‘beyond pathetic’ racist messages about COVID-19 – Fox Sports
Former Australian Open champion Naomi Osaka has called out "beyond pathetic” racist posts against Asian people relating to COVID-19 on social media.

The reigning US Open champion took to Twitter ahead of the seasons first grand slam after noticing disgusting comments online.
Osaka, who has taken stands in recent years including supporting the Black Lives Matter movement, said it was concerning how little attention was being paid to the matter.
